I received numerous resposes regarding the availability of Smail 3.0 for
XENIX.  The long and short of it is that the source code is available in
what has been referred to as a controlled alpha-release.

A couple of individuals who responded indicated that Smail 3.0 is an
extremely large program and for UUCP only sites Smail 2.5 is entirely
adequate.

Before I jump into the throes of bringing 3.0 up I have decided, as long as I
have the source code here, to get Smail 2.5 running and see how it works in
this environment.  I know there are XENIX specific patches required for 2.5
and I think these patches include a re-write of XENIX's execmail utility.  I
would appreciate it if anyone can tell me where these patches are stored so
I can pick them up.  Replies either via e-mail or to the net would be
satisfactory.  Thanks in advance.
